Study Design and Tools
This study is a descriptive, retrospective claims analysis
conducted
using
the
Anticoagulant
Quality
Improve
-
ment Analyzer software, a condition-specific software
tool designed to evaluate population characteristics,
population health risks, and appropriateness of medication
use by allowing health plans to upload their pharmacy
and medical claims data via a simple point-andclick
method. A randomly selected 10% sample of
patients from the PharMetrics Integrated Database was
analyzed in this study by using this automated Health
Insurance Portability and Accountability Act–compliant
software
tool
to
produce
results
for
a
series
of
predetermined
and user-defined measures and to generate
actionable, patient/prescriber-level, overall sample-specific
reports.
A
10%
sample
of
this
database
was
deemed
sufficient
to provide an appropriate number of patients
to accurately represent treatment patterns within the
population of patients with AF; indeed, nearly 26,000
patients with AF who met the inclusion criteria for this
study were identified in this 10% sample.
